The US machine tools market represents a cornerstone of industrial manufacturing and precision engineering, encompassing equipment such as lathes, milling machines, grinders, and CNC (computer numerical control) systems. These tools are the backbone of sectors ranging from automotive and aerospace to defense and electronics, enabling the production of highly accurate and repeatable components. As the manufacturing landscape evolves with the adoption of automation, advanced materials, and digital solutions, understanding the machine tools market share offers insight into broader economic health and technological direction. This market is shaped by innovation, capital investment cycles, workforce capabilities, and global competitive pressures that influence which companies and technologies gain prominence.

Historically, the United States has been a pivotal player in machine tool development, with its industry contributing significantly to manufacturing efficiency and competitiveness. The transition from manual to automated and then digitally integrated machine tools reflects both technological progress and changing industry expectations. Today’s machine tools are not only concerned with cutting metal or composites but are integrated within digital ecosystems that support data analytics, adaptive control, and enhanced shop floor coordination. As such, players in this market vie for share by offering not just hardware but comprehensive solutions that improve productivity and operational insight.

Market Drivers and Competitive Factors

Several drivers propel the US machine tools market and define how market share is distributed among competitors. Foremost among them is the demand for precision and speed. Manufacturing sectors that rely on tight tolerances — such as aerospace and medical devices — require machine tools capable of high accuracy while maintaining throughput. Vendors who deliver machines with advanced control systems, rigidity, and adaptive machining strategies are often preferred by these industries, capturing significant market presence.

Another driver is the integration of CNC and robotics technologies that enable automated and lights-out machining environments. This automation reduces dependence on manual intervention and allows shops to scale production without proportionately increasing labor costs. Companies that embed robust automation features into their machines, coupled with intuitive software interfaces that support ease of programming and monitoring, often achieve competitive advantage. Furthermore, the ability to retrofit existing machines with digital upgrades has become a focal point for manufacturers who want to extend equipment life and extract more value from capital investments.

Workforce skill development is both a driver and a challenge for the market. As machine tools become more advanced, the need for operators and maintenance personnel with higher technical proficiency increases. Organizations that invest in training programs and collaborate with educational institutions help pave the way for a skilled pipeline, indirectly supporting adoption and reinforcing the reputations of machine tool suppliers that advocate for holistic industry growth. This ecosystem approach influences market share by aligning supplier success with broader workforce readiness.

Challenges and Industry Trends

Despite its strengths, the US machine tools market encounters challenges that affect how players compete. Global competition, particularly from regions with lower production costs, places pressure on domestic manufacturers to innovate while controlling price points. While many US machine tool builders focus on high performance and customization, smaller shops often seek cost-competitive options that still meet essential quality benchmarks. Balancing these divergent needs shapes how companies position themselves and how market share evolves.

Trade policies and supply chain disruptions also play significant roles. Machine tools often incorporate complex components sourced from international suppliers, and fluctuations in freight costs or tariff landscapes can affect pricing and delivery timelines. Suppliers who manage resilient supply networks and local sourcing strategies can better navigate these uncertainties, potentially securing customer trust and market share.

An additional trend is the convergence of machine tool functions with digital manufacturing platforms. With the rise of smart factories, machine tools are expected to communicate seamlessly with enterprise systems, enabling real-time feedback, predictive maintenance, and adaptive process control. Vendors that excel in embedding connectivity standards, open architectures, and data analytics capabilities differentiate themselves in a crowded field. As manufacturers increasingly adopt these capabilities, market share tilts toward those who deliver not just machines but systems that support integrated digital operations.

Future Outlook and Growth Opportunities

Looking forward, the US machine tools market is poised for continued transformation. Emerging technologies such as additive manufacturing (3D printing) are either complementing or redefining traditional subtractive machining approaches. Hybrid systems that combine additive and subtractive capabilities allow complex part production with reduced setup times, challenging conventional boundaries and expanding machine tool applications. As industries adopt these hybrid strategies, machine tool builders who innovate in hybrid platforms can capture new segments of market share.

Environmental sustainability is another area influencing future growth. Energy-efficient machine designs, reduced waste machining strategies, and materials recycling are becoming priorities for manufacturers seeking to align with corporate sustainability goals. Machine tools that support eco-efficient operations offer value beyond performance metrics, appealing to customers who integrate sustainability into procurement decisions.

Moreover, as industries continue to emphasize customization and rapid product development, flexible manufacturing solutions enabled by programmable machine tools will gain traction. Manufacturers that understand and respond to diverse application requirements — from small batch runs to high volume production — are better positioned to expand their footprint across varied industrial ecosystems.

In essence, the US machine tools market share reflects a dynamic balance between technological innovation, customer needs, global competition, and industry transformation. Companies that align their strategies with evolving manufacturing paradigms — including automation, connectivity, and sustainability — will influence market direction and gain enduring relevance.
